City parks function important communal spaces that foster social interactions amongst numerous populations. This observational analysis article goals to explore the dynamics of social interactions in city parks, specializing in how numerous elements akin to time of day, park design, and demographic characteristics affect the character and frequency of these interactions. The study was performed in Central Park, New York City, over a period of 4 weeks, during which completely different instances of day and weather conditions were observed to gather a complete understanding of social behaviors in this urban setting.



To start, the methodology involved systematic commentary of park-goers at varied locations within Central Park, together with well-liked areas resembling the great Lawn, Bethesda Terrace, and the Bow Bridge. Observations had been carried out throughout peak hours (weekends and weekday afternoons) as well as off-peak instances (early mornings and late evenings). The purpose was to capture a variety of social interactions, from informal greetings between strangers to extra intimate gatherings among buddies and families.



In the course of the observations, it became evident that the time of day significantly influenced the kind of interactions observed. As an example, weekend afternoons have been bustling with exercise, as families and teams of mates gathered for picnics, games, and leisure activities. The environment was vibrant, with laughter and dialog filling the air. In distinction, early mornings presented a quieter scene, with individuals engaged in solitary actions corresponding to jogging, reading, or meditating. These solitary park-goers usually interacted minimally, primarily acknowledging others with nods or temporary smiles.



The park design also played a vital function in shaping social interactions. Areas with open spaces, akin to the great Lawn, encouraged larger gatherings and facilitated group activities. Observations noted that individuals have been extra doubtless to interact in video games or group sports activities in these open areas, resulting in spontaneous interactions amongst contributors and onlookers alike. In contrast, extra secluded spots, such as the shaded benches near the water, tended to draw people looking for solitude or intimate conversations, usually leading to a quieter ambiance where interactions had been more subdued and private.



Demographic traits of park-goers have been one other vital issue influencing social interactions. Observations revealed that households with kids have been extra likely to congregate in playground areas, where children’s laughter served as a catalyst for social engagement among mother and father. Parents usually struck up conversations with each other, sharing parenting tips or discussing native occasions. Conversely, youthful individuals, notably college college students, had been usually observed in teams close to recreational facilities, partaking in sports activities or socializing over shared pursuits. These interactions have been characterized by a extra casual and energetic tone, reflective of their age group.



Moreover, the presence of dogs within the park proved to be a unique facilitator of social interactions. Canine house owners ceaselessly engaged in conversations with different dog homeowners, sharing anecdotes about their pets or discussing coaching tips. This phenomenon highlights the role of shared interests in fostering connections amongst people who would possibly otherwise stay strangers. The presence of canine also attracted consideration from non-homeowners, leading to interactions that have been often light-hearted and pleasant.



Weather circumstances had been one other variable that influenced the character of social interactions. On sunny days, the park was crammed with guests, and interactions were plentiful. Folks were extra inclined to engage with one another, whether or not through informal conversations or organized activities. Conversely, rainy days saw a major decrease in park attendance, resulting in fewer interactions. Those that braved the weather usually sought shelter below timber or pavilions, resulting in a extra subdued atmosphere where interactions had been limited to transient exchanges.



Along with observing interactions, the examine also centered on the emotional tone of social exchanges. Constructive interactions, characterized by laughter, smiles, and animated conversations, had been notably more prevalent throughout peak hours and in areas designed for socialization. In contrast, unfavourable interactions, resembling arguments or displays of frustration, had been infrequent however did happen, notably in crowded areas where private house was restricted. These observations recommend that the design and usage of city parks can significantly impression the emotional local weather of social interactions.



The role of technology in social interactions was additionally a noteworthy commentary. While many park-goers engaged in face-to-face interactions, a major quantity were observed using their smartphones, both to take pictures or to communicate with others remotely. This phenomenon raises questions concerning the stability between digital and in-person interactions in city parks. While expertise can enhance the expertise by permitting people to share moments with mates or household who are usually not present, it may detract from the quality of in-person interactions, as people might change into absorbed of their devices moderately than participating with these around them.



In conclusion, this observational examine of social interactions in Central Park highlights the advanced interplay of various elements that affect how individuals connect in urban environments. Time of day, park design, demographic traits, weather circumstances, and the role of technology all contribute to the dynamics of social interactions. Understanding these components can provide helpful insights for urban planners and group organizers looking for to create spaces that foster social engagement and neighborhood building. As urban areas continue to develop, the importance of effectively-designed public areas that encourage optimistic social interactions can't be overstated. Future research could broaden on these findings by exploring similar dynamics in different city parks or by analyzing the long-time period effects of social interactions on group cohesion and particular person effectively-being.
